Key Features
- Nominal pressure: 125 PSI
- Size: 6 inches (168.28 mm outside diameter)
- Thickness: 5.2 mm
- Weight: 3.99 kg per meter (lightweight for easy transport and installation)
- SDR: 32.5
- Color: Gray
- Length: 6 meters standard; other lengths available upon request
- Complies with ASTM D 2241
